A city received 17 inches of rain last year which was only 37% of what the usually get, how many inches doe it normally get?

Answer:

We have 17 inches = (37/100) · x;

x = 17 ÷ (37/100);

x = 17 · (100/37);

x = 1700 / 37;

x ≈ 46;
